• <tr id="yyy80"></tr>
  • <sup id="yyy80"></sup>
  • <tfoot id="yyy80"><noscript id="yyy80"></noscript></tfoot>
  • 99热精品在线国产_美女午夜性视频免费_国产精品国产高清国产av_av欧美777_自拍偷自拍亚洲精品老妇_亚洲熟女精品中文字幕_www日本黄色视频网_国产精品野战在线观看 ?

    基于JSP技術(shù)辦公自動(dòng)化系統(tǒng)的設(shè)計(jì)實(shí)現(xiàn)

    2014-01-01 00:00:00郭新

    摘 要:文章以濮陽公務(wù)員培訓(xùn)中心的實(shí)際情況為基礎(chǔ),設(shè)計(jì)實(shí)現(xiàn)相應(yīng)的辦公自動(dòng)化系統(tǒng)。按照軟件工程的要求,對(duì)系統(tǒng)進(jìn)行設(shè)計(jì)實(shí)現(xiàn)及測試?;贘SP的辦公自動(dòng)化系統(tǒng)的建設(shè)為背景,主要設(shè)計(jì)和實(shí)現(xiàn)濮陽公務(wù)員培訓(xùn)中心的網(wǎng)絡(luò)辦公系統(tǒng)的各個(gè)功能,并做出實(shí)例測試。

    關(guān)鍵詞:JSP技術(shù);辦公自動(dòng)化系統(tǒng);設(shè)計(jì)實(shí)現(xiàn);測試

    中圖分類號(hào):TP317.1

    在對(duì)培訓(xùn)中心的實(shí)際辦公情況進(jìn)行調(diào)查、整理及系統(tǒng)分析的基礎(chǔ)上,對(duì)辦公自動(dòng)化系統(tǒng)的數(shù)據(jù)庫進(jìn)行了完善,同時(shí)在設(shè)計(jì)完成了系統(tǒng)的WEB界面。在完成了初步的系統(tǒng)需求分析及技術(shù)分析的前提下,從“做什么”到“怎么做”。接照系統(tǒng)設(shè)計(jì)的原則,開始對(duì)系統(tǒng)進(jìn)行設(shè)計(jì)實(shí)現(xiàn)和測試。主要以對(duì)系統(tǒng)的主要模塊的設(shè)計(jì)和實(shí)現(xiàn)為體現(xiàn),僅以登錄模塊為例進(jìn)行說明。

    1 設(shè)計(jì)實(shí)現(xiàn)系統(tǒng)主要功能模塊

    系統(tǒng)關(guān)鍵功能模塊主要有:登錄、個(gè)人賬號(hào)管理模塊、員工個(gè)人信息管理及員工在線狀態(tài)管理、優(yōu)秀員工管理模塊、接發(fā)短消息、查看及處理公文公告、各級(jí)部門管理、員工狀態(tài)管理模塊等。開發(fā)與實(shí)現(xiàn)視圖層各個(gè)關(guān)鍵模塊。僅對(duì)登錄模塊來體現(xiàn)對(duì)系統(tǒng)的設(shè)計(jì)實(shí)現(xiàn)過程。

    進(jìn)入系統(tǒng)首先要進(jìn)行登錄,所以登錄模塊是整個(gè)系統(tǒng)的門戶,圖1即為系統(tǒng)的登錄首頁界面。在界面中需要正確輸入個(gè)人的賬號(hào)和密碼后,點(diǎn)擊確定按鈕等待系統(tǒng)判斷進(jìn)入。系統(tǒng)在判斷登錄信息已經(jīng)正確前提下,根據(jù)輸入賬號(hào)判斷登錄者的身份,主要判斷區(qū)別登錄者是管理員還是其他登錄者。其系統(tǒng)管理流程圖如圖2所示。

    圖1 系統(tǒng)登錄模塊界面圖 圖2 系統(tǒng)登錄模塊流程圖

    在系統(tǒng)對(duì)登錄輸入的賬號(hào)和密碼做出正確的判斷后,系統(tǒng)就會(huì)轉(zhuǎn)入后臺(tái)工作,在后臺(tái)中把登錄輸入的信息與員工密碼信息表的信息進(jìn)行比對(duì),從而對(duì)登錄者的使用權(quán)限做出判斷,并根據(jù)判斷適時(shí)給予相應(yīng)的使用權(quán)限。整個(gè)權(quán)限級(jí)別的判斷過程都是由后臺(tái)的另一個(gè)檢測系統(tǒng)進(jìn)行完成。具體的權(quán)限授予規(guī)則是:

    (1)如果登錄者為系統(tǒng)管理員賬號(hào),管理員賬號(hào)幾乎擁有系統(tǒng)操作的全部權(quán)限,在對(duì)系統(tǒng)的管理操作中,特別是對(duì)系統(tǒng)數(shù)據(jù)庫的操作,具有對(duì)數(shù)據(jù)庫表的創(chuàng)建及刪除等主要功能,這個(gè)權(quán)限只有對(duì)系統(tǒng)進(jìn)行維護(hù)的人員才可擁有。

    (2)如果登錄賬號(hào)是中心的領(lǐng)導(dǎo)級(jí)別,其擁有對(duì)數(shù)據(jù)庫中相關(guān)授權(quán)數(shù)據(jù)的操作權(quán)限,比如,添加公文公告記錄、刪除和修改員工的個(gè)人信息、查詢員工在線信息等功能。

    (3)如果登錄者是中心一般科員,其權(quán)限是最小的,只能查收和瀏覽相關(guān)數(shù)據(jù),也可相互收發(fā)信息,但無權(quán)對(duì)數(shù)據(jù)進(jìn)行修改和刪除。

    2 系統(tǒng)測試

    針對(duì)濮陽市公務(wù)員培訓(xùn)中心辦公自動(dòng)化系統(tǒng)的功能,依據(jù)不同用戶的測試流程,設(shè)計(jì)了部分測試用例,在進(jìn)行系統(tǒng)登錄界面的前提下。

    表1 針對(duì)個(gè)人用戶登錄功能的部分測試用例

    測試用例ID輸入信息操作過程估計(jì)輸出輸出結(jié)果

    賬號(hào)密碼

    0001757501輸入信息并確定無輸出

    000246hihi輸入信息并確定賬號(hào)與密碼不符登錄失敗

    0003 7501輸入信息并確定賬號(hào)不能為空登錄失敗

    0004Hi 1234輸入信息并確定賬號(hào)不存在登錄失敗

    表2 針對(duì)員工收發(fā)信息功能的測試用例

    用例ID數(shù)據(jù)輸入操作過程估計(jì)輸出輸出結(jié)果

    接收賬號(hào)信息標(biāo)題信息內(nèi)容

    00531 在發(fā)送短信息頁面,單擊”發(fā)送”提示”請輸入標(biāo)題”標(biāo)題不能為空,發(fā)送失敗

    001032單位聚餐 在發(fā)送短信息頁面,單擊”發(fā)送”提示”不允許發(fā)送空白消息”內(nèi)容不能為空,發(fā)送失敗

    001133單位聚餐3月8日晚7點(diǎn)在單位食堂聚餐在發(fā)送短信息頁面,單擊”發(fā)送”發(fā)送成功發(fā)送成功

    001234單位聚餐3月8日晚7點(diǎn)在單位食堂聚餐在查看短信息頁面,單擊”單位聚餐”可看到具體的信息內(nèi)容,且新信息狀態(tài)變成”已讀”成功查看短信息

    001335單位聚餐3月8日晚7點(diǎn)在單位食堂聚餐單擊查看短信息頁面中”刪除”信息已刪除刪除成功

    表3 針對(duì)管理員管理短信息功能的測試用例

    用例ID輸入信息操作過程輸出估計(jì)結(jié)果

    43月8日晚7點(diǎn)在單位食堂聚餐管理員界面-短信息管理所有員工之間的信息發(fā)送情況列表顯示成功

    53月8日晚7點(diǎn)在單位食堂聚餐管理員界面-短信息管理刪除短信息刪除成功

    參考文獻(xiàn):

    [1]sun.Servlet與JSP核心編程[M].北京:清華大學(xué)出版社,2004:62-68.

    [2]尹秀君.網(wǎng)絡(luò)辦公自動(dòng)化系統(tǒng)的開發(fā)與應(yīng)用.數(shù)字天地.

    作者簡介:郭新(1977-),女,河南濮陽人,講師,碩士。

    作者單位:濮陽職業(yè)技術(shù)學(xué)院數(shù)學(xué)與信息工程系,河南濮陽 457000

    宁城县| 方城县| 南涧| 贡觉县| 舟曲县| 通山县| 杭锦旗| 望江县| 大冶市| 兴业县| 都匀市| 巩留县| 金沙县| 富阳市| 泰兴市| 双江| 元谋县| 瓮安县| 颍上县| 育儿| 会宁县| 那坡县| 波密县| 扎兰屯市| 泰安市| 西吉县| 阜南县| 灌阳县| 锡林郭勒盟| 泾阳县| 西贡区| 襄汾县| 邻水| 宁武县| 泰安市| 楚雄市| 阿瓦提县| 盐池县| 安西县| 无为县| 巴林左旗|